Info from this episode:
🔥 Fireplace (a.k.a. Early Heating System)
- ~500,000 BCE
- Inventor: Early humans (Homo erectus)
- Fireplaces became structured “hearths” in ancient Greece & Rome.
☕ Thermos (Vacuum Flask)
- 1892
- Inventor: Sir James Dewar (Scottish chemist)
🧶 Wool Clothing (Mittens/Scarves/Socks)
- ~3000 BCE (first wool garments in Mesopotamia)
- Inventors: Ancient Mesopotamians
🔧 Snow Shovel
- Dated back to ~1000 BCE, first used by indigenous Arctic peoples
- Modern aluminum snow shovel patented in 1889 by Joseph Flanders
